Solution for -4(1+k)=-3-3k equation:


Simplifying
-4(1 + k) = -3 + -3k
(1 * -4 + k * -4) = -3 + -3k
(-4 + -4k) = -3 + -3k

Solving
-4 + -4k = -3 + -3k

Solving for variable 'k'.

Move all terms containing k to the left, all other terms to the right.

Add '3k' to each side of the equation.
-4 + -4k + 3k = -3 + -3k + 3k

Combine like terms: -4k + 3k = -1k
-4 + -1k = -3 + -3k + 3k

Combine like terms: -3k + 3k = 0
-4 + -1k = -3 + 0
-4 + -1k = -3

Add '4' to each side of the equation.
-4 + 4 + -1k = -3 + 4

Combine like terms: -4 + 4 = 0
0 + -1k = -3 + 4
-1k = -3 + 4

Combine like terms: -3 + 4 = 1
-1k = 1

Divide each side by '-1'.
k = -1

Simplifying
k = -1
